Lateral Reinstatement Cutters
One of the most critical parts of sewer rehabilitation is the reconnection of the laterals after a sewer pipe has been relined. Depending on the length and location of the relining project, an underground contractor may need to reinstate just a few lateral connections or have a large job of more than 1,000. Proper tooling is a must to make this process go smoothly and quickly.

Raptor Reinstatement Cutter
ARIES' RAPTOR Cutter is the most reliable cutter system to reinstate and remove protruding laterals in the industry. The Raptor is manufactured of stainless steel and bronze construction and is mechanically engineered for stable performance in 6-to 24-in. lines . A separate grinding head is provided for removing line deposits and protruding taps. Motor sizes include .7, 1 and 1.5 hp The cutter controller is designed for operator convenience and multiple operations simultaneously via a single joystick operation.
DanCutter
The DanCutter series of reinstatement cutter are all manufactured in all stainless steel and for use in all types of short and small diameter pipe-lines, sewer-pipes, water pipes etc. They are designed for use in diameter ranges of 3" through 10" diameters up 80 meters in length. The DanCutter's design perfect for grinding away protruding service connections, roots and many other forms of deposits prior to relining. DanCutter can be used in conjunction with a standard ARIES TV/Cutting system or it can be used as a stand alone system with any TV inspection system. The DanCutters are moved through the pipelines with an electric winch or pushed with the DanCutter Automatic Feed System. The automatic feed functions by two sets of conical gears driven sinultaneaously via dual motors/transmission asemblies. The autofeed system can push the cutter up to 50 meters from a single entry point.
